
Ex-gambling bosses facing UK criminal trial lose civil case against regulator
🤖AI Özeti
Kenny Alexander and Lee Feldman, former executives of Entain, have lost a civil lawsuit against the UK Gambling Commission, which they accused of violating their privacy rights. The case was dismissed, and both men have been ordered to pay the regulator's legal costs. This comes as they face separate criminal charges related to bribery and fraud. Their lawsuit stemmed from the Gambling Commission's intervention in their attempt to acquire the online casino company 888.
